Create Group

See more Microsoft Group Examples

Create a new group as specified in the request body. You can create one of three types of groups:
  • Office 365 Group (unified group)
  • Dynamic group
  • Security group

This operation returns by default only a subset of the properties for each group. These default properties are noted in the Properties section.

#include <CkHttp.h>
#include <CkJsonObject.h>
#include <CkHttpResponse.h>

void ChilkatSample(void)
    {
    bool success = false;

    //  This example requires the Chilkat API to have been previously unlocked.
    //  See Global Unlock Sample for sample code.

    CkHttp http;

    //  Use your previously obtained access token as shown here:
    //     Get Microsoft Graph OAuth2 Access Token with Group.ReadWrite.All scope.

    CkJsonObject jsonToken;
    success = jsonToken.LoadFile("qa_data/tokens/msGraphGroup.json");
    if (success == false) {
        std::cout << jsonToken.lastErrorText() << "\r\n";
        return;
    }

    http.put_AuthToken(jsonToken.stringOf("access_token"));

    //  Create a JSON body for the HTTP POST
    //  Use this online tool to generate the code from sample JSON: 
    //  Generate Code to Create JSON

    //  {
    //    "description": "Self help community for library",
    //    "displayName": "Library Assist",
    //    "groupTypes": [
    //      "Unified"
    //    ],
    //    "mailEnabled": true,
    //    "mailNickname": "library",
    //    "securityEnabled": false
    //  }

    CkJsonObject json;
    json.UpdateString("description","Self help community for library");
    json.UpdateString("displayName","Library Assist");
    json.UpdateString("groupTypes[0]","Unified");
    json.UpdateBool("mailEnabled",true);
    json.UpdateString("mailNickname","library");
    json.UpdateBool("securityEnabled",false);

    //  POST the JSON to https://graph.microsoft.com/v1.0/groups

    CkHttpResponse resp;
    success = http.HttpJson("POST","https://graph.microsoft.com/v1.0/groups",json,"application/json",resp);
    if (success == false) {
        std::cout << http.lastErrorText() << "\r\n";
        return;
    }

    json.Load(resp.bodyStr());
    json.put_EmitCompact(false);

    if (resp.get_StatusCode() != 201) {
        std::cout << json.emit() << "\r\n";
        std::cout << "Failed, response status code = " << resp.get_StatusCode() << "\r\n";
        return;
    }

    std::cout << json.emit() << "\r\n";

    //  A sample response:
    //  (See code for parsing this response below..)

    //  {
    //      "id": "b320ee12-b1cd-4cca-b648-a437be61c5cd",
    //  	  "deletedDateTime": null,
    //  	  "classification": null,
    //  	  "createdDateTime": "2018-12-22T00:51:37Z",
    //  	  "creationOptions": [],
    //  	  "description": "Self help community for library",
    //  	  "displayName": "Library Assist",
    //  	  "groupTypes": [
    //  	      "Unified"
    //  	  ],
    //  	  "mail": "library7423@contoso.com",
    //  	  "mailEnabled": true,
    //  	  "mailNickname": "library",
    //  	  "onPremisesLastSyncDateTime": null,
    //  	  "onPremisesSecurityIdentifier": null,
    //  	  "onPremisesSyncEnabled": null,
    //  	  "preferredDataLocation": "CAN",
    //  	  "proxyAddresses": [
    //  	      "SMTP:library7423@contoso.com"
    //  	  ],
    //  	  "renewedDateTime": "2018-12-22T00:51:37Z",
    //  	  "resourceBehaviorOptions": [],
    //  	  "resourceProvisioningOptions": [],
    //  	  "securityEnabled": false,
    //  	  "visibility": "Public",
    //  	  "onPremisesProvisioningErrors": []
    //  }

    //  Use this online tool to generate parsing code from sample JSON: 
    //  Generate Parsing Code from JSON

    const char *id = 0;
    const char *deletedDateTime = 0;
    const char *classification = 0;
    const char *createdDateTime = 0;
    const char *description = 0;
    const char *displayName = 0;
    const char *mail = 0;
    bool mailEnabled;
    const char *mailNickname = 0;
    const char *onPremisesLastSyncDateTime = 0;
    const char *onPremisesSecurityIdentifier = 0;
    const char *onPremisesSyncEnabled = 0;
    const char *preferredDataLocation = 0;
    const char *renewedDateTime = 0;
    bool securityEnabled;
    const char *visibility = 0;
    int i;
    int count_i;
    const char *strVal = 0;

    id = json.stringOf("id");
    deletedDateTime = json.stringOf("deletedDateTime");
    classification = json.stringOf("classification");
    createdDateTime = json.stringOf("createdDateTime");
    description = json.stringOf("description");
    displayName = json.stringOf("displayName");
    mail = json.stringOf("mail");
    mailEnabled = json.BoolOf("mailEnabled");
    mailNickname = json.stringOf("mailNickname");
    onPremisesLastSyncDateTime = json.stringOf("onPremisesLastSyncDateTime");
    onPremisesSecurityIdentifier = json.stringOf("onPremisesSecurityIdentifier");
    onPremisesSyncEnabled = json.stringOf("onPremisesSyncEnabled");
    preferredDataLocation = json.stringOf("preferredDataLocation");
    renewedDateTime = json.stringOf("renewedDateTime");
    securityEnabled = json.BoolOf("securityEnabled");
    visibility = json.stringOf("visibility");
    i = 0;
    count_i = json.SizeOfArray("creationOptions");
    while (i < count_i) {
        json.put_I(i);
        i = i + 1;
    }

    i = 0;
    count_i = json.SizeOfArray("groupTypes");
    while (i < count_i) {
        json.put_I(i);
        strVal = json.stringOf("groupTypes[i]");
        i = i + 1;
    }

    i = 0;
    count_i = json.SizeOfArray("proxyAddresses");
    while (i < count_i) {
        json.put_I(i);
        strVal = json.stringOf("proxyAddresses[i]");
        i = i + 1;
    }

    i = 0;
    count_i = json.SizeOfArray("resourceBehaviorOptions");
    while (i < count_i) {
        json.put_I(i);
        //  ...
        i = i + 1;
    }

    i = 0;
    count_i = json.SizeOfArray("resourceProvisioningOptions");
    while (i < count_i) {
        json.put_I(i);
        //  ...
        i = i + 1;
    }

    i = 0;
    count_i = json.SizeOfArray("onPremisesProvisioningErrors");
    while (i < count_i) {
        json.put_I(i);
        //  ...
        i = i + 1;
    }

    std::cout << "Success." << "\r\n";
    }
